Transaction 9ec690dd820962dbb27cbb762e88b33bd3a2f06469558deef0510e3653618fb6
1 Input
1 Output
-
9ec690dd820962dbb27cbb762e88b33bd3a2f06469558deef0510e3653618fb6:0
- value
- 25589
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c3424023c13ed27a3e7bbd8d12d41834bf8538d
- address
- bc1qhs6zgq3uz0kj0gl8h0vdzt2psd9ls5udgj7hx2